Baked Zucchini Fries
Recipe adapted by me from Our Best Bites

About 1 large zucchini
1/4 c. Italian-seasoned bread crumbs
1/4 c. grated Parmesan cheese (the crumbly stuff, not shreds)

1/4 c. Batter Mix (I use Fry Krisp, it's the best!)
2 eggs
Preheat oven to 425. Spray a baking sheet with non-stick cooking spray. Set aside.
Combine bread crumbs, Parmesan cheese and batter mix. Set aside.
Whisk 2 eggs together in a shallow pie plate and set aside.
Cut the zucchini into a french fry shape.
Dip the zucchini sticks in the egg, shake them to remove any excess, and then roll them in the bread crumbs. Place the coated strips on the prepared baking sheet and repeat until all the zucchini strips have been coated.
Bake for 10-12 minutes in the prepared oven then remove from oven, flip the fries, and bake for another 10-12 minutes or until the zucchini is not soggy and the coating is crisp and golden brown.
